2. Pivot with Jenny Blake
Host Jenny Blake will help you open your eyes to look for opportunities in places you may have never expected. Based on her book, Pivot: The Only Move That Matters Is Your Next One, Blake brings her audience in on conversations between herself and other professionals on the best tools and methods for bringing yourself success. If you’re a fan of thinking outside the box, or maybe you struggle to do just that, Blake and her friends can help give you the push you’ve been looking for.

4. Masters in Business
Put out by Bloomberg Opinion columnist, Barry Ritholtz, this podcast will provide any entrepreneur with useful insight on who’s shaping the market and how they did it. Learn all you’ll need to know about investing and business straight from the mouths of those who have already mastered it (see how the name pulls in there?).

6. StartUp
If you’ve ever been interested in starting your own business, we highly recommend you give this podcast a listen to. Seasons one and two follow the beginning of two companies and their journey towards success, but season three focuses on a new business every episode. 8. Entrepreneurs on Fire
John Lee Dumas hosts this award-winning podcast series where he interviews entrepreneurs that are at the peak of their careers. If you’ve ever wanted to start your own business, this is the podcast for you. And there’s plenty of episodes, so you’ll never run out of new material to listen to.
9. The School of Greatness
This podcast covers a lot of different topics. Hosted by Lewis Howes, whose story is both touching and inspiring, he tackles everything from relationships, family, business, and more. He talks to celebrities and professionals to provide you with insight and tips on how to get to where they are.

11. Goal Driven Professionals
As the name suggests, this podcast hosted by Jared LaVergne focuses on improving client relationships, return on investment, and customer acquisition costs for anyone running an independent business or service by conversing with professionals who have done just that. Bringing in experts from all industries, LaVergne seeks to help his audience learn more about what it actually takes to find success in the business world.
12. The Angie Lee Show
Having dropped out of college and the world of big corporate business, Angie Lee was able to build herself up using her wit and determination to become a keynote speaker, podcaster, author, and entrepreneur. Geared towards helping women make a difference in the workforce, Lee will tell it like it is while still keeping a positive attitude.
